Drcody Posted March 11 #1 Share Posted March 11 My wife and I will be making the voyage from Fort Lauderdale to Athens, Greece. We are seeking other passengers on the same voyage who would like to form a small group (4-8 people) to book a small group excursion in order to save money. I have found and communicated with a local independent tour guide (highly rated on TripAdvisor) who offers tours of the island – either short (3-4 hours) or long (4-5 hours) to various locations. After spending several hours researching tours, I have discovered that by booking directly through the tour owner/operator you can save a SIGNIFICANT amount of money compared to tours offer aboard the ship. And yes, this tour provider has specific tours designed for tourists arriving by cruise ship thereby ensuring he will get all back in plenty of time to re-board the ship. His prices are E 45 = $49 per person/$98 couple for the short tours and E 55 = $60 per person/$120 couple for the longer tours. Compare these prices with what Holland America is offering and you’ll understand why I’m trying to put together a small group. His website is: Azoreantours.com . Once there, click on Shore Excursions to see the different tours he offers. To make it perfectly clear – I do not get any “kick back” or discount by having others book a tour. The owner needs a minimum number of passengers to run any of the tours which is why I am reaching out to fellow passengers.
